Calgary Stampeders Pull Off a Nail-Biter Against Ottawa Redblacks

The Calgary Stampeders edged the Ottawa Redblacks by a two‑point margin in a late‑season showdown on Saturday, September 19, 2026 .

The Stampeders managed to edge out the Redblacks with a thrilling 40-38 victory, thanks to a jaw-dropping 62-yard field goal by Rene Paredes. Yes, you read that right—62 yards! On the flip side, the Ottawa Redblacks are having a season they’d probably prefer to forget. With this loss, they dropped to a dismal 0-13. Yes, you read that right—zero wins and thirteen losses.
